1.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is the definition of potential energy?
Back
Potential energy is the stored energy in an object due to its position or state.
2.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is kinetic energy?
Back
Kinetic energy is the energy of an object due to its motion.
3.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
At which point is potential energy greatest in a roller coaster?
Back
At the highest point of the track.
4.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
How does increasing an object's speed affect its kinetic energy?
Back
Increasing an object's speed increases its kinetic energy.
5.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is the formula for calculating kinetic energy?
Back
Kinetic energy (KE) = 1/2 mv², where m is mass and v is velocity.
6.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is the relationship between potential energy and kinetic energy in a closed system?
Back
In a closed system, the total mechanical energy (potential + kinetic) remains constant.
7.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
At what position does a rock have the greatest kinetic energy when thrown?
Back
At the lowest point of its trajectory.
